Do You Put Wax On Skateboard. Wax on the bottom of the board’s worn regions, including the deck & baseplate. Rather than melting it onto the skateboard to cover the pores and provide a slicker surfing/boarding surface, skateboard wax is often rubbed onto surfaces to make them slippery. While this application appears to be unconventional, many skaters use it. Skateboarding wax is usually made from a paraffin base, and it helps reduce the friction you get when you slide or grind down rails, curbs, and other hard surfaces. In some cases, wax is necessary to grind a surface as the surface friction of the ledge will stop the board from grinding. Skateboard wax is not used in the same way that you would use wax on a surfboard or snowboard. The wax acts as a lubricant and makes it possible to grind on a rough.
